Worry and anxiety
Anxiety is not a character flaw and it is not weak faith. It is a body doing what it was built to do, at a moment when it is not needed. The practices here work on the loop itself: what worry promises and never delivers, what avoiding costs you, and how to let the body come down.
What works for this
Cognitive behavioural therapy
The treatment with the largest trial base for anxiety works on what you do about worry rather than on what you worry about. Catching it, postponing it, and testing a prediction instead of arguing with it.
One move, today
Pick one worry you had today. Write the exact thing you feared would happen, then write what actually happened. You are collecting evidence, not arguing.
